aboutsummaryrefslogtreecommitdiffhomepage
path: root/crates/mozart-sat-resolver/src
diff options
context:
space:
mode:
authornsfisis <nsfisis@gmail.com>2026-02-22 18:56:01 +0900
committernsfisis <nsfisis@gmail.com>2026-02-22 18:56:01 +0900
commit6c3235e17b1bad265fc407d9bdb673122c3bada3 (patch)
tree057350899682bf57d7725243e0c6868b1088e53d /crates/mozart-sat-resolver/src
parent6f7171ead0d352101cd75d2bc0222d708870f55b (diff)
downloadphp-mozart-6c3235e17b1bad265fc407d9bdb673122c3bada3.tar.gz
php-mozart-6c3235e17b1bad265fc407d9bdb673122c3bada3.tar.zst
php-mozart-6c3235e17b1bad265fc407d9bdb673122c3bada3.zip
feat(audit): display version info in audit output
Use previously stored but unused fields: show installed_version in advisory tables/plain/JSON output, and package version in abandoned package output. Remove unused unlockable_ids field from LockTransaction.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
Diffstat (limited to 'crates/mozart-sat-resolver/src')
-rw-r--r--crates/mozart-sat-resolver/src/transaction.rs4
1 files changed, 0 insertions, 4 deletions
diff --git a/crates/mozart-sat-resolver/src/transaction.rs b/crates/mozart-sat-resolver/src/transaction.rs
index 6462870..a325601 100644
--- a/crates/mozart-sat-resolver/src/transaction.rs
+++ b/crates/mozart-sat-resolver/src/transaction.rs
@@ -257,9 +257,6 @@ impl<'a> Transaction<'a> {
pub struct LockTransaction<'a> {
/// The base transaction.
transaction: Transaction<'a>,
- /// Package IDs that cannot be updated (platform, root, fixed repos).
- #[allow(dead_code)]
- unlockable_ids: HashSet<PackageId>,
/// All result package IDs.
all_result_ids: Vec<PackageId>,
/// Non-dev result package IDs.
@@ -294,7 +291,6 @@ impl<'a> LockTransaction<'a> {
LockTransaction {
transaction,
- unlockable_ids,
all_result_ids,
non_dev_ids,
dev_ids: Vec::new(),